I have a remote configuration from Windows7 (64 bit) to a Linux x86_64
(Ubuntu11.10). I set the Notebook kernel to remote. When I execute (2+2)
I get a password window. On the remote machine I see that the
authentication passed and I see that a remote math session to be launched:

tsariysk 19772  0.0  0.0 235828 20268 ?        Ssl  07:40   0:00
/usr/local/Wolfram/Mathematica/8.0/SystemFiles/Kernel/Binaries/Linux-x86-64/MathKernel
-mathlink -LinkMode Connect -LinkProtocol TCPIP -LinkName
52956 at 192.168.1.153,52957 at 192.168.1.153 -LinkHost 192.168.191.14

Still,  (2+2) is never evaluated.  After a while I get an error message:

"The kernel craft28 failed to connect to the front end. (Error =
MLECONNECT). You should try running the kernel connection outside the
front end."

which I do  not understand. What is wrong and how can I track this problem?
